我一直在努力处理这段简单的代码而没有结果.我只是想在XML变量中添加一个新节点.
DECLARE @XML XML;
SET @XML = '<root>
<policyData>
<txtComentario />
<idRegProducto>76</idRegProducto>
<txtDuracion>24</txtDuracion>
</policyData>
</root>';
DECLARE @NODE XML;
SET @NODE = '<newNode>10</newNode>';
SET @XML.modify
('insert sql:variable("@NODE") as first
into (/root/policyData)[0]')
SELECT @XML;
Run Code Online (Sandbox Code Playgroud)
没有错误,但新节点未显示在输出中.在SQL Server中使用XML之前,我必须首先设置一些东西吗?有什么建议为什么这不起作用?
提前致谢!
我正在尝试在Visual Studio 2017社区版中添加对System.Configuration程序集的引用.我的目标是.net 4.5版和.net classic.但是,我在参考管理器中找不到任何程序集.
我在这里错过了什么吗?标准框架组件在哪里?Framework选项卡是空的是正常的吗?
我有一个SSIS包,在他的OLEDB目的地有一个NVARCHAR(MAX)字段.该字段甚至没有被数据流填充.数据流任务失败,并显示错误"无法创建OLE DB访问者.验证列元数据是否有效".
我看到了类似的问题:如何修复SSIS中的多步OLE DB操作错误?并根据它的建议检查了我的元数据.我发现SSIS将违规列映射为NTEXT而不是DT_WSTR.我尝试将其类型更改为长度为8000的DT_WSTR,但仍然会出现相同的错误.还尝试用NULL填充字段,同样的错误.将"验证外部元数据"设置为false并没有任何区别.有关如何解决它的任何建议?
谢谢.
我只是从node.js和表达框架开始,遵循本教程:
http://expressjs.com/starter/generator.html
在控制台中运行后express myapp,cd myapp && npm install当我运行时node app.js没有任何反应.该命令立即返回,而我期待它等待传入的消息.也没有显示错误.我使用的是Windows 7 x64,命令是从ADMIN控制台运行的.任何帮助将不胜感激.
我正在构建一个ssis包,我希望在Script Component中使用现有的OleDbConnection.这是我的代码:
public override void AcquireConnections(object Transaction)
{
base.AcquireConnections(Transaction);
cm = this.Connections.Connection;
con = (OleDbConnection)cm.AcquireConnection(Transaction);
MessageBox.Show(con.ToString());
}
Run Code Online (Sandbox Code Playgroud)
当我关闭BIDS时,我收到以下消息:"System.InvalidCastException:无法将类型为'System .__ ComObject'的COM对象强制转换为类类型'System.Data.OleDb.OleDbConnection'.表示COM组件的类型的实例不能是转换为不代表COM组件的类型;但只要底层COM组件支持对接口的IID的QueryInterface调用,它们就可以转换为接口.
使用Ado.Net连接时,相同的代码可以正常工作.我可以在这里使用OleDbConnection,或者Script Component仅支持Ado.Net吗?
提前致谢.
将数据插入SQL表时出现错误。
“错误是System.Data.SqlClient.SqlException:'')附近的语法不正确。'
Sql Table Detail是。
USE [d]
GO
/****** Object: Table [dbo].[data] Script Date: 2/20/2018 6:32:54 PM ******/
SET ANSI_NULLS ON
GO
SET QUOTED_IDENTIFIER ON
GO
CREATE TABLE [dbo].[data](
[no] [int] NOT NULL,
[name] [nvarchar](50) NULL,
CONSTRAINT [PK_data] PRIMARY KEY CLUSTERED
(
[no] ASC
)W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Y]
) ON [PRIMARY]
GO
INSERT [dbo].[data] ([no], [name]) VALUES (10138, N'Mark')
GO
INSERT [dbo].[data] ([no], [name]) VALUES (40014, …Run Code Online (Sandbox Code Playgroud) 我正在尝试为我的 NETCORE 应用程序构建 Docker 映像,但是当我从 Visual Studio 运行“构建 Docker 映像”菜单时,它会抛出错误:
无法使用前端 dockerfile.v0 解决:无法读取 dockerfile:打开 /var/lib/docker/tmp/buildkit-mount861662899/dockerfile:没有这样的文件或目录 5>C:\Users\xxxx.nuget\packages\microsoft。 Visualstudio.azure.containers.tools.targets\1.9.10\build\Container.targets(198,5):错误CTC1001:未启用卷共享。在 Docker Desktop 的“设置”屏幕上,单击“共享驱动器”,然后选择包含项目文件的驱动器。
当我尝试启用卷共享时,我无法在 Docker 设置中找到该选项。所有文档都说它应该位于“资源”选项下。
我正在使用 WSL2 集成,但不知道它是否与该问题有关。
我的发布管道在工作几个月后今天开始失败。我无法找到有关此错误的任何信息。这是设置System.Debug=true后的相关日志。
2019-06-03T09:12:56.1141807Z Package deployment using ZIP Deploy initiated.
2019-06-03T09:12:56.1227504Z ##[debug][POST]https://$DuoCore__staging:***@xxx-staging.scm.azurewebsites.net/api/zipdeploy?deployer=VSTS&message=%7B%22type%22%3A%22deployment%22%2C%22commitId%22%3A%2241ea351fc04ac594f9a979d19117e494e03c30aa%22%2C%22buildId%22%3A%223477%22%2C%22releaseId%22%3A%221780%22%2C%22buildNumber%22%3A%2220190602.1%22%2C%22releaseName%22%3A%22Release-37%22%2C%22repoProvider%22%3A%22TfsGit%22%2C%22repoName%22%3A%22xxxFront%22%2C%22collectionUrl%22%3A%22https%3A%2F%2Fvectorcuatrogroup.visualstudio.com%2F%22%2C%22teamProject%22%3A%223a39c617-c412-480d-aa54-be5cca265a43%22%2C%22slotName%22%3A%22Staging%22%7D
2019-06-03T09:12:56.2135188Z ##[debug]Could not parse response: {}
2019-06-03T09:12:56.2135454Z ##[debug]Response: undefined
2019-06-03T09:12:56.2137686Z ##[debug]ZIP Deploy response: {"statusCode":403,"statusMessage":"Ip Forbidden","headers":{"content-type":"text/html","server":"Microsoft-IIS/10.0","date":"Mon, 03 Jun 2019 09:12:55 GMT","connection":"close","content-length":"2399"},"body":"<!DOCTYPE html>\r\n<html>\r\n<head>\r\n <title>Web App - Unavailable</title>\r\n <style type=\"text/css\">\r\n html {\r\n height: 100%;\r\n width: 100%;\r\n }\r\n\r\n #feature {\r\n width: 960px;\r\n margin: 95px auto 0 auto;\r\n overflow: auto;\r\n }\r\n\r\n #content {\r\n font-family: \"Segoe UI\";\r\n font-weight: normal;\r\n font-size: 22px;\r\n color: #ffffff;\r\n float: left;\r\n width: 460px;\r\n margin-top: 68px;\r\n margin-left: 0px;\r\n vertical-align: middle;\r\n }\r\n\r\n #content h1 …Run Code Online (Sandbox Code Playgroud) 从Windows Phone应用程序读取.txt文件时遇到问题.
我做了一个简单的应用程序,它从.txt文件中读取一个流并打印出来.
不幸的是,我来自意大利,我们有很多带口音的字母.这就是问题所在,事实上所有重音字母都打印成问号.
这是示例代码:
var resourceStream = Application.GetResourceStream(new Uri("frasi.txt",UriKind.RelativeOrAbsolute));
if (resourceStream != null)
{
{
//System.Text.Encoding.Default, true
using (var reader = new StreamReader(resourceStream.Stream, System.Text.Encoding.UTF8))
{
string line;
line = reader.ReadLine();
while (line != null)
{
frasi.Add(line);
line = reader.ReadLine();
}
}
}
Run Code Online (Sandbox Code Playgroud)
所以,我问你如何避免这件事.
祝一切顺利.
[编辑:]解决方案:我没有确保文件是用UTF-8编码的 - 我用正确的编码保存它,它就像一个魅力.谢谢奥斯卡
我有以下型号:
基类:
public abstract class Identifiable{
private ObjectId id;
private string name;
protected Identifiable(){
id = ObjectId.GenerateNewId();
}
[BsonId]
public ObjectId Id{
get { return id; }
set { id = value; }
}
[BsonRequired]
public string Name{
get { return name; }
set { name = value; }
}
}
Run Code Online (Sandbox Code Playgroud)
这个名字很独特.
一个频道类
public class Channel : Identifiable{
private DateTime creationDate;
private string url;
private DailyPrograming dailyPrograming;
public DailyPrograming DailyPrograming{
get { return dailyPrograming; }
set { dailyPrograming = value; …Run Code Online (Sandbox Code Playgroud) c# ×3
sql-server ×3
.net ×2
ssis ×2
.net-core ×1
azure ×1
azure-devops ×1
azure-pipelines-release-pipeline ×1
docker ×1
encoding ×1
express ×1
mongodb ×1
node.js ×1
t-sql ×1
winforms ×1
xml ×1
xquery-sql ×1